The thing that hurts you the most about not knowing what you own, comes when you're utilizing a timeshare resale business. The lazy seller lets the listing agent fill in the blanks on the listing type with little input. I have actually seen the specific very same timeshare noted on a site estimated with different upkeep costs, square video footage, sleeping capacity season and more. what is a land timeshare. The personnel word when it pertains to offering your timeshare is "selling". Your listing requires to stand out so you require to sharpen your sales skills. I have actually seen many a timeshare resale company with several listings for the very same resort, utilize the specific same terminology to describe the resort in each and every listing.
You desire your listing to stand out from all of the other ones. You can start by changing the description. Discuss why you enjoy the resort and how lots of great memories you and your household made while on vacation. If your system is fixed is it a corner or upstairs one with terrific views, extra outdoor patio space or parking right in front of the system? In many timeshare resales, the seller is anticipated to spend for the closing expenses and transfer charges. Not understanding these costs can kill your deal rapidly. If you're using a resale business, they will have the ability to provide you the quote. If you are offering it yourself and using an escrow company you will need to contact them for that details. According to Sharket, a timeshare market research company, "The major title business are charging anywhere from $350 to $550 to hold escrow and prepare the deed (more if you reside timeshare exit in a state where an attorney is needed to tape the deed).
